Where insurance is not just a necessity, but an opportunity to protect and thrive. As specialist commercial insurance brokers, we understand the unique challenges faced by businesses in today’s ever-evolving landscape.
Registered in the England & Wales, Company no. 7445220
Authorised & Regulated by the Financial Conduct Authority, FRN: 545924